The SMT workshop in the electronics factory is divided into DIP line and SMT line.

SMT refers to surface mount technology, in which electronic components are punched through a device onto a PCB and then heated in an oven to secure the components to the PCB.
DIP refers to a hand-inserted component, such as a large connector, that the device cannot prepare to be inserted into the PCB by a human or other automated device.
SMT line mainly includes solder paste printer, SMT machine material, pre-furnace visual inspection, post-furnace visual inspection, packaging and so on.
DIP line mainly includes plate throwing staff, plate removing staff, plug-in staff, furnace workers, post-furnace welding spot inspection and so on.
Question 1, is SMT workshop harmful to human body?
The SMT workshop needs to be ventilated, and employees need to wear overalls and protective gloves during work because of the exposure to some chemicals. There is no harm to human health in the case of good protection, but if you have allergies, you need to report in advance to prevent accidents.

Question 2,is this a good job?
SMT machine operators are basically on guard duty and can walk around during work because of the need to pick up materials. The labor intensity of the post is average, so we need to know some professional knowledge of machine operation. If we take the initiative to learn equipment maintenance through our own efforts, we will have a good skill in the future job hunting, which can be considered as a technical post.
